Fullscreen Names East Coast Sales VP

socalTECH

Culver City-based YouTube network Fullscreen said Tuesday that it has hired Justin Danko as Vice President of Sales and Brand Strategy, East Coast. Danko was previously VP of Branded Entertainment at Viacom Media Networks, working on MTVN Music Group and MTV Entertainment Group; he also worked at Comedy Central and USA Network.

GraphEffect Ramps Sales, Marketing

socalTECH

Santa Monica-based GraphEffect , the venture-backed developer of social marketing software, said today that it has hired both a Sales and Marketing VP. The firm said it has appointed David Pollet as Vice President of Sales, and named Jennifer Cooley as Vice President of Marketing and Business Development.
